Best 33060 Florida Public Charter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public charter school serving 439 students in 33060, FL.
The top ranked public charter school in 33060, FL is Innovation Charter School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public charter school in zipcode 33060 have an average math proficiency score of 54% (versus the Florida public charter school average of 58%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 59% statewide average). Charter schools in 33060, FL have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Florida public charter schools.
Minority enrollment is 96%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Florida public charter school average of 72% (majority Hispanic).
